Core Viewpoint - Natural Hall, a well-known domestic beauty brand, is facing challenges in profitability and research and development, despite its historical significance and market presence [2][4]. Financial Performance - Revenue for Natural Hall from 2022 to 2024 is projected to be 4.292 billion, 4.442 billion, and 4.601 billion yuan, with net profits of 139 million, 302 million, and 190 million yuan respectively [4]. - The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for revenue from 2022 to 2024 is only 3.5%, significantly lower than the industry average of 6.6% [4]. Revenue Structure - Approximately 90% of Natural Hall's revenue is derived from its core brand, "Natural Hall," indicating a heavy reliance on a single brand [5][6]. - The other four brands under Natural Hall contribute only about 5% of total revenue, highlighting limited market influence [7]. Marketing and R&D Expenditure - Natural Hall maintains a high gross margin, but its net profit margin fluctuates between 3.2% and 7.8%, which is considerably lower than competitors [9]. - Marketing expenses from 2022 to 2024 exceeded 7.5 billion yuan, while R&D investment was only about 348 million yuan, indicating a marketing-to-R&D expenditure ratio of 21.55 times [10][11]. Channel Strategy - Online revenue share increased from 59.7% to 68.8% from 2022 to the first half of 2025, while offline revenue share decreased to around 30% [12]. - Despite the growth in online sales, Natural Hall continues to expand its offline retail presence, with over 62,700 retail terminals as of mid-2025 [13]. Corporate Governance - Natural Hall is a family-controlled business, with the Zheng family holding 87.82% of voting rights, ensuring significant control over strategic decisions [14]. - The company recently brought in strategic investors, including L'Oréal and CVC Capital, while maintaining family control over the board [15]. Market Position and Challenges - The Chinese cosmetics market is projected to grow from 779.4 billion yuan in 2019 to 934.6 billion yuan in 2024, with domestic brands expected to capture over 50% market share by 2025 [16]. - Natural Hall's reliance on celebrity endorsements poses risks, as seen with recent controversies affecting brand reputation [16][17].
